当前位置:编程学习 > C#/ASP.NET >>

按了删除键后怎么先弹出一个框框警告要不要删除?

请问怎么在这段程序里面加入点击删除键后,弹出确认删除对话框?? 的程序,谢谢。

private void DataShow_DeleteCommand(object source, System.Web.UI.WebControls.DataGridCommandEventArgs e)
{

string strSql = "delete from tbl_WorkOrdr where ID="+e.Item.Cells[0].Text+"";

ExecuteSql(strSql);
} --------------------编程问答-------------------- <ItemTemplate>
                    <asp:LinkButton ID="LinkButton1" runat="server" CausesValidation="False" CommandName="Delete"
                    OnClientClick='return   confirm("你确定你要删除吗?");'  
                        Text="删除"></asp:LinkButton>
                </ItemTemplate> --------------------编程问答-------------------- onclick="JavaScript:return confirm('确定要永久删除吗?')">删除</div>" --------------------编程问答-------------------- 错了,应该是
<asp:ButtonColumn Text="<div id="delete" onclick="JavaScript:return confirm('确定要永久删除吗?')">删除</div>"
HeaderText="删除" CommandName="Delete">
<HeaderStyle Wrap="False" ForeColor="White"></HeaderStyle>

另外,同意1楼的 --------------------编程问答-------------------- protected void DataShow_RowDataBound(object sender, GridViewRowEventArgs e)
    {
        if (e.Row.RowType == DataControlRowType.DataRow)
        {
            删除控件类型 db = (删除控件类型)e.Row.Cells[0].Controls[0];
            db.OnClientClick = string.Format("return confirm('你确定要删除吗?'));
        }
    } --------------------编程问答-------------------- protected void Repeater1_ItemCreated(object sender, RepeaterItemEventArgs e)
    {
        if (e.Item.ItemType == ListItemType.Item || e.Item.ItemType == ListItemType.AlternatingItem)
        {
            LinkButton lb = new LinkButton();
            lb = (LinkButton)e.Item.FindControl("LinkButton1");
            lb.Attributes.Add("onclick", "return confirm('确定要将此文章删除吗?');");

        }
    } --------------------编程问答--------------------

protected   void   DataShow_RowDataBound(object   sender,   GridViewRowEventArgs   e) 
        { 
                if   (e.Row.RowType   ==   DataControlRowType.DataRow) 
                { 
                         LinkButton   lb   =  (LinkButton)e.Item.FindControl( "LinkButton1"); 
                        lb.Attributes.Add( "onclick ",   "return   confirm( '确定要删除吗? '); "); 

                } 
        }
补充:.NET技术 ,  ASP.NET
CopyRight © 2022 站长资源库 编程知识问答 zzzyk.com All Rights Reserved
部分文章来自网络,